Investigation confirmed the cursor implementation re-sorted results between pages after a recent index change, allowing rows to shift position mid-traversal. No data was exposed beyond each caller's authorized scope; the defect affected ordering only. A fix pinning cursor snapshots to a stable sort key was deployed at 11:02 and verified against replayed traffic. The deployed artifact is identified by the trace token below.

session token of fahap-hawip = htk31_7852f2b3276dba2738f98fa97f92237

Ticket #—: Vault locked, blocking fix for report builder sort stability. The Cadencia report builder reorders rows with equal sort keys between runs; the fix requires patching the comparator module, which is stored in the sealed deploy vault. The vault auto-locked after three failed attempts by the previous on-call. Per policy, the vault can be reopened with the team recovery passphrase, which is provided on the line below.

strongbox words: wenix-ulador

Hey there, plugin author! TallyGate is the counter service that tracks turnstile clicks across every entrance at Bramblewick Arena. Your plugin hooks into the count stream after aggregation, so you'll get clean per-gate numbers once per minute — no raw sensor noise to worry about. Keep your handlers fast; anything over 200ms gets dropped from the pipeline. Sample plugins, the event payload spec, and the sandbox setup guide are all collected on our developer portal page.

runbook for tafof-yawif: https://confluence.tolvaqsys.internal/display/display/browse/pages/7be3

### Seat-Map Renderer — Orpheum Lane Theatre

The renderer for the Gildhall ticketing app draws the Orpheum Lane seat map as tiled canvas layers. Zoom levels above the threshold switch from vector seats to rasterized sprites to keep frame times stable. If you're on call and see dropped frames or blank tiles, the usual culprit is an overloaded tile queue or a too-aggressive prefetch radius. Current tuning values are as follows.

tuning table, yajog-yahof:
BUDGETS = {
    "lamvan": 303,
    "wenox": 460,
    "fenvan": 525,
}